About this school
Hyde Park Middle School is
an urban public school
in Las Vegas, Nevada that is part of Clark County School District.
It serves 1,371 students
in grades 6 - 8 with a student/teacher ratio of 20.5:1.
Its teachers have had 64 projects funded on DonorsChoose.
